Five inspiring Thai female entrepreneurs from across different regions of Thailand, who had won the pre-selection process from the provincial pitching rounds came to Bangkok, showcased and pitched their innovative businesses to a high-level jury.
We are thrilled to congratulate the winner of the final pitching round, Khun Thamonwan (Amm) Virodchaiyan and her company Moreloop who will embark on a business trip to Austria this summer to attend business meetings, exchange and explore the possibilities of market expansion to Europe. Moreloop offers an online marketplace for quality surplus fabric, transforming waste from the fashion industry into valuable resources.

We are happy to be part of such an inspiring program. This initiative was led by the International Institute for Trade and Development (the project owner), Thammasat University (the implementing agency), and co-hosted with UN Women Asia and the Pacific.
